文摘Objective: To evaluate the effect of brachytherapy intracavitary residual tumor on patients with NPC after radiation therapy Methods: Five hundred sixty three NPC with residual tumor in the nasopharynx were treated with large dose of brachytherapy (2025 Gy) The treatment results were retropectively evaluated Results: Within 3 months after brachytherapy, the overall regression rate of the residual tumor was 90 4% Upon long term follow up, the 1 , 3 and 5 year survival rate was 89 65%, 67 01% and 55 42%, respectively The major complications of the after loading treatment were nasal obstruction (16 2%), necrosis of the nasopharynx (0 9%) and perforation of soft foliate in 2 patients Conclusion Brachytherapy is effective in the treatment of residual NPC especially in patients in early stage It may not be helpful to stage IV patients
